pytorch 2.1
时间: 2025-02-24 16:38:32 浏览: 49
### PyTorch 2.1 版本信息
PyTorch 2.1 是一个重要的更新版本,带来了多项性能改进和新功能。该版本继续优化了分布式训练的支持,并增强了对多种硬件平台的兼容性[^1]。
对于CUDA 11.4的支持情况,在选择合适的PyTorch版本时确实需要注意CUDA版本匹配问题。由于当前使用的NVIDIA驱动程序对应的是CUDA 11.4,因此建议查找与之相适应的具体PyTorch构建版本。
### 安装指南
考虑到基础环境为WSL2下的Ubuntu 22.04以及Miniconda的存在,推荐通过Conda来管理Python包及其依赖关系。具体操作如下:
#### 创建并激活一个新的conda环境
```bash
conda create --name pytorch_env python=3.9 -y
conda activate pytorch_env
```
#### 使用pip安装特定版本的PyTorch
鉴于官方已不再提供长期支持(LTS),可直接访问官网获取适合CUDA 11.4的最佳配置命令:
```bash
pip install torch torchvision torchaudio --extra-index-url https://download.pytorch.org/whl/cu114
```
此命令会自动下载适用于指定CUDA版本的PyTorch及相关库文件。
### 新特性概述
PyTorch 2.1引入了一些值得关注的新特性和增强之处,主要包括但不限于以下几个方面:
- **Dynamo编译器集成**: 提升模型推理速度的同时保持灵活性。
- **更强大的API接口设计**: 增加更多实用工具函数简化开发流程。
- **扩展性的提升**: 支持更多的第三方框架插件接入。
为了深入了解这些变化带来的影响,可以查阅详细的发布说明文档以获得完整的改动列表和技术细节。
阅读全文
相关推荐

















